ANNA K. JEFFRIES
ROANOKE, Va. - Anna K. Jeffries, 93, of Roanoke, formerly of Frostburg, died Sunday, Sept. 26, 1999.

Born Oct. 12, 1905, in Zihlman, Md., she was the daughter of the late John J. and Laura I. (Stevens) Koontz. She also was preceded in death by her husband, James Jeffries in 1972.

Mrs. Jeffries was a former Allegany County teacher. She was a member of Salem United Church of Christ.

Surviving are two daughters, Kay Brandenburg and husband Robert, Hagerstown, Md., and Jean Toggweiler and husband Richard, Roanoke; six grandchildren and 10 great-grandchildren.

Mrs. Jeffries has been cremated.

Friends will be received at the Sowers Funeral Home, P.A., 60 W. Main St., Frostburg, Md., on Friday from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m.

A memorial service will be held there on Saturday at 11 a.m. with the Rev. Lawrence A. Neumark officiating.

Inurnment will be in Frostburg Memorial Park.

RUTH M. LEWIS
CUMBERLAND - Ruth Mae (Howdershell) Lewis, 89, of Cumberland, went to be with the Lord on Saturday, July 17, 1999, at her residence in the presence of her family.

Born June 17, 1910, in Moorefield, W.Va., she was the daughter of the late James Robert and Nora (Wolfe) Howdershell. She also was preceded in death by her husband, James Thomas Gerald Lewis; three sons, Andrew Jackson Lewis, Harold Edwin Lewis and Ronald Carroll Lewis; and two brothers, Harold Marvin Howdershell and Dalvin Howdershell.

Mrs. Lewis was a member of Winifred Road Church of Christ, exemplified Christian love and character, and will be sadly missed by her children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ren.

Surviving are three sons, James Franklin Lewis and wife Barbara, Bowling Green, Thomas Gerald Lewis and wife Elise, Humble, Texas, and Herbert Otis Lewis and wife Noreen, Madison, Tenn.; four daughters, Geraldine Taylor, Cumberland, Madore Duncan, Shaft, Jenny Lewis, Nashville, Tenn., and Patricia McTaggart, Cumberland; one sister, Ina Ludwig, Baltimore; 16 grandchildren; 25 great-grandchildren; and one great-great-granchild.

Friends will be received at the Scarpelli Funeral Home, P.A., 108 Virginia Ave., Cumberland, on Monday from 3 to 5 and 7 to 9 p.m.

Services will be conducted at the funeral home on Tuesday at 1 p.m. with the Rev. John R. Herbst and the Rev. Joe Penick officiating.

Interment will be in Sunset Memorial Park.

Pallbearers will be Fred Lewis, Donnie Lewis, Clarence "Pooch" Lewis, Johnny Ludwig, Kenneth Buckalew and Donald Taylor.

Memorial contributions may be made to the Western Maryland Hospice Unit.

The family extends a heartfelt appreciation to Carol McKenzie and all the staff at the Western Maryland Hospice and Home Healthcare for the tender care that was given to her.

MONA C. HERSHBERGER
KITZMILLER - Mona Caroline Hershberger, age 56, of Kitzmiller, died Sunday, March 21, 1999, at her residence.

Born Jan. 22, 1943, in Vindex, she was a daughter of Helen (Tasker) Burrell and the late Woodrow Harvey. She was also preceded in death by her step father, Jimmy Burrell; and one sister, Irene Love.

In addition to her mother she is survived by one brother, Gordie Harvey and wife, Karen, Baltimore; and one sister, Margie Rhodes and husband, Harold, Keyser, W.Va.

Friends will be received at the David A. Burdock Funeral Home, Kitzmiller, on Tuesday from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m.

Funeral services will be held on Wednesday at 1 p.m. in the funeral home chapel with the Rev. Donald Nelson officiating.

Interment will be in the Mount Zion Cemetery, Mount Zion.

RUTH H. HIGGINS
FROSTBURG - Ruth Hughes Higgins, 76, of Frostburg, died Oct. 13, 1999, at the Calvert County Nursing Center in Prince Frederick, where she was a resident since July. She also was preceded in death by her husband, Andrew Higgins, formerly of Frostburg, and one brother, Benjamin Hughes, Frostburg.

Born June 10, 1923, in Frostburg, she was the daughter of the late Benjamin Hughes Sr. and Mary (Walker) Hughes.

Mrs. Higgins was a graduate of Beall High School class of 1941. She was employed by the G.C. Murphy Company until her retirement. She and her husband Andy moved to Melbourne, Fla., in 1987, and she returned to Frostburg in May, 1996.

Mrs. Higgins was a member of the Beall High School Alumni Association, the Frostburg Women of the Moose Lodge, Chapter 221, and was a life-long member of Saint John's Episcopal Church.

Surviving are one daughter Connie Blank Sullivan and husband Ronald Sullivan, Huntingtown; one son Andrew Higgins and wife Adrienne, Point of Rocks; one sister-in-law Rebecca Hughes, Frostburg; five grandchildren, Stephen Sullivan and wife Jenna Gallion, Cumberland, Katherine, Andrew Brady, Elizabeth Higgins, Centreville, Va., and Devan Fennesy, Point of Rocks; two nieces, Lynn Tudor, Glen Allen, Va., and Nancy Hughes, Columbia; and two grandnieces, Rebecca Wheless, Pawleys Island, N.C., and Jennifer Hammond, Raleigh, N.C.

At Mrs. Higgins' request, her body was cremated.

A memorial mass will be celebrated at Saint John's Episcopal Church, 58 Broadway, Frostburg, Saturday, Oct. 30 at 11 a.m. with Father Thomas Staupp officiating. The family will receive friends at the church one hour before the mass.

Inurnment will be in the Frostburg Memorial Park.

Memorial gifts may be made in Mrs. Higgins' memory to the Saint John's Episcopal Church Building Fund.

The Sowers Funeral Home, P.A., Frostburg, is in charge of arrangements.

SHIRLEY J. KRAUSE (VAN METER)
CUMBERLAND - Shirley Jean Krause, 63, of 13603 Yuma St., SW, Potomac Park, Cumberland, died Wednesday, Aug. 4, 1999, at Sacred Heart Hospital.

Born March 23, 1936, in Cumberland, she was the daughter of the late Norman Ray Van Meter and Belva (Krothers) Van Meter. She also was preceded in death by two sisters, Wanda Lee Zembower and Geraldine Herrera.

Mrs. Krause was a homemaker.

Surviving are her husband, Ronald Darrell Krause; one son, Ronald D. Krause Jr., Cumberland; three brothers, Milton L. Van Meter, James B. Van Meter Sr. and William R. Van Meter, all of Cumberland; and three sisters, Mary L. Houdersheldt, Wiley Ford, W.Va., Joan L. Weatherholt and Linda K. Meanyhan, both of Cumberland.

Friends will be received at the Merritt-Adams Funeral Home, P.A., 404 Decatur St., Cumberland, on Friday from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m.

Services will be conducted at the funeral home on Saturday at 11 a.m.
